Building a Successful Business: Forecasting & Budgeting
In the dynamic world of finance, accurate forecasting and meticulous budgeting are crucial for navigating uncertainties and achieving your business goals. A well-structured forecast provides a comprehensive roadmap of expected revenues and expenses, enabling you to make informed decisions. Meanwhile, a robust budget acts as a guideline, allocating resources effectively and ensuring efficient utilization. By combining the power of forecasting and budgeting, businesses can limit risks, maximize profitability, and pave the way for sustainable growth.
- Successful forecasting involves analyzing historical data, industry trends, and market conditions to create a realistic projection of future performance.
- A comprehensive budget outlines funds across various departments and activities, ensuring that resources are allocated with strategic objectives.
- Regularly evaluating your forecast and budget allows for course correction based on changing circumstances.
Variance Analysis: Identifying Performance Gaps
Variance analysis is a powerful tool for assessing business performance and pinpointing areas where actual results deviate from planned targets. By comparing variances, businesses can uncover the root causes of these deviations and take corrective measures to improve future outcomes.
A key aspect of variance analysis is the determination of significant variances. These are discrepancies that fall outside a predetermined range, signaling potential problems or opportunities for optimization. By exploring these significant variances, businesses can obtain valuable insights into the factors driving their performance and deploy targeted solutions to address them.
Additionally, variance analysis provides a framework for monitoring performance over time. By analyzing trends in variances, businesses can spot emerging patterns and anticipate future challenges or opportunities. This prospective approach allows businesses to adapt their strategies proactively and remain competitive in a dynamic market environment.
